您当前的位置:首页 > 电脑百科 > 网络技术 > 网络知识

IPv4和IPv6基本知识点专题分享,带你一分钟全部掌握

时间:2019-11-13 09:26:49  来源:  作者:

1、IPv4

Internet Protocol version 4

地址长度:32位,约43亿个

表示法:点分十进制表示法,/后表示网络号长度(如192.168.1.1/24表示,IP地址前24位表示网络号)

IPv4地址可以分5类:

分类 前缀 地址范围 用途 描述

A类 0 0.0.0.0-127.255.255.255 单播/特殊 7位网络号,24位主机号

B类 10 128.0.0.0-191.255.255.255 单播/特殊 14位网络号,16位主机号

C类 110 192.0.0.0-223.255.255.255 单播/特殊 21位网络号,8位主机号

D类 1110 224.0.0.0-239.255.255.255 组播 组播地址

E类 1111 240.0.0.0-255.255.255.255 保留 保留地址,全1地址为广播

特殊的IPv4地址:

10.0.0.0/8 家庭、办公室、企业的私网地址

172.16.0.0/12 家庭、办公室、企业的私网地址

192.168.0.0/16 家庭、办公室、企业的私网地址

169.254.0.0/16 Link-local地址,只在本网段有效,路由器不转发此地址

127.0.0.0/8 环回地址

224.0.0.0/4 组播地址

240.0.0.0/4 供测试使用保留

255.255.255.255 广播

IPv4报文首部:

字段 长度 作用

版本 4bit IP类型,0100表示ipv4,0110表示ipv6

首部长度 4bit 首部长度,单位4byte

DSCP 6bit 区分服务代码点

ECN 2bit 拥塞标识符

总长度 16bit 包括IP报头的总长度

标识 16bit 与标记字段和分片偏移字段共同用于IP报文分片控制

标记 3bit 第1位未使用,第2位是不分段位DF

分片偏移 13bit 单位8byte,指明分段起始点,相对于报头的偏移

生存期 8bit TTL,IP报文被转发过程中,每遇到一个路由器,TTL减1,目的是防环

协议类型 8bit 应用层或传输层协议类型

头部校验和 16bit 针对IP报头的纠错字段

源IP地址 32bit 源地址

目的IP地址 32bit 目的地址

可选项 小于40byte

根据IPv4地址和子网掩码确定网络号、子网号、主机号:

(1)根据IP地址的高位可知道一个地址属于哪一类地址,比如172.16.1.1,根据172得知这是一个B类地址,网络号长度为14位

(2)根据子网掩码可以知道网络号和子网号的位数,比如172.16.1.1,子网掩码255.255.255.0,则前24位为网络号,后8位为主机号

(3)综上,172.16.1.1/24的前14位为网络号,中间8位为子网号,后8位为主机号

2、IPv6

Internet Protocol version 6

地址长度:128位,数量很多,多到地球表面每平方能分到300亿亿个地址

ipv6地址的表示法:

基本 ABCD:EF01:2345:6789:ABCD:EF01:2345:6789

带子网号 ABCD:EF01:2345:6789:ABCD:EF01:2345:6789/64

带端口号 [ABCD:EF01:2345:6789:ABCD:EF01:2345:6789]:8080

ipv6地址的分类:

单播 对应一个接口,报文由这个接口接收

任播 对应一组接口,报文由组内某个接口接收

组播 对应一组接口,组内所有接口都接收这个报文

特殊的ipv6地址:

::/128 全0,未指定使用方式的地址

::1/128 最后一位为1,其余为0,环回地址

FF00::/8 组播地址

FE80::/10 本地链路单播地址,即Link-local地址

ipv6报文首部:

字段 长度 作用

版本 4bit 0110是ipv6

DSCP 6bit 区分服务代码点

ECN 2bit 拥塞标识符

流标签 20bit 标记报文数据流类型,区分不同报文,由源节点分配

负载长度 16bit 单位1byte,除了基本头部以外的部分的长度

下一个头部 8bit 当前报头的下一个头部类型,可能是上层协议或扩展报头

跳数限制 8bit 类似于ipv4的TTL

源IP地址 128bit 源地址

目的IP地址 128bit 目的地址

IPv6地址的组织方式:

(1)前48位为路由选择前缀(相当于网络号)

(2)中间16位为子网ID(子网号)

(3)最后64位作为接口ID(主机ID)

因为IPv6地址足够多,所以其地址组织方式显得没IPv4那么拥挤和节省

3、IPv6对于IPv4的优势:

(1)IPv6地址空间更大。128位地址提供的地址数量远超IPv4的32位地址(取之无尽的IP地址资源)

(2)路由表更小,使路由转发效率更高(网速提升)

(3)增强的组播及对流的控制,提高了网络多媒体应用的QoS(是多媒体应用泛滥的当今时代的福音)

(4)支持自动配置,对DHCP的扩展,更方便管理网络(尤其是LAN)

(5)安全性更高,允许对网络层数据加密

(6)允许协议扩充

(7)更灵活的首部格式,使用扩展头部概念

(8)新的选项



Tags:IPv6   点击:()  评论:()
声明:本站部分内容及图片来自互联网,转载是出于传递更多信息之目的,内容观点仅代表作者本人,如有任何标注错误或版权侵犯请与我们联系(Email:2595517585@qq.com),我们将及时更正、删除,谢谢。
▌相关推荐
问题背景IPv6环境下,在浏览器中通过http://[vip:port]访问web业务,提示无法访问此网站,[vip]的响应时间过长。分析过程之前碰到过多次在PC浏览器上无法访问vip的情况,排查方法也...【详细内容】
2021-12-13  Tags: IPv6  点击:(28)  评论:(0)  加入收藏
IPv6是英文“Internet Protocol Version 6”(互联网协议第6版)的缩写,是互联网工程任务组(IETF)设计的用于替代IPv4的下一代IP协议,其地址数量号称可以为全世界的每一粒沙子编上一...【详细内容】
2021-11-23  Tags: IPv6  点击:(35)  评论:(0)  加入收藏
一、前言:•20世纪80年代,IETF(Internet Engineering Task Force,因特网工程任务组)发布RFC791,即IPv4协议,标志IPv4正式标准化。在此后的几十年间,IPv4协议成为最主流的协议之...【详细内容】
2021-03-09  Tags: IPv6  点击:(371)  评论:(0)  加入收藏
IPv6过渡技术1、双栈技术网络中所有的设备都需要支持 IPv6 和 IPv4 协议。对设备要求较高。2、IPv6 over IPv4 隧道技术用于过渡初期,IPv4 网络为主体,IPv6 网络是孤岛,需要通...【详细内容】
2021-03-03  Tags: IPv6  点击:(233)  评论:(0)  加入收藏
不推荐任何读者改用移动宽带,本文只适用于已经在用移动宽带的用户 前言话说笔者自从搬家后,居住的区域没有了联通宽带资源,之前一直在使用的联通大王卡宽带就没法用了,那可是1元...【详细内容】
2020-12-18  Tags: IPv6  点击:(13771)  评论:(0)  加入收藏
IPv6地址划分 如图所示,地址分为三大类:组播、单播、任意播(也称泛播);单播可分为:全球单播地址(可理解为公网地址---IPv6)、本地链路地址、站点本地地址、回环地址、未指定地址、内...【详细内容】
2020-10-28  Tags: IPv6  点击:(263)  评论:(0)  加入收藏
伴随5G、IoT等技术的发展,企业应用全面上云,给信息网络提出了新的诉求,网络逐步云化、IPv6化、全光化。关于网络变化的趋势,工信部科技委常务副主任、中国电信集团科技委主任韦...【详细内容】
2020-10-14  Tags: IPv6  点击:(96)  评论:(0)  加入收藏
之前,小编介绍了几个IPv6的使用姿势,不知道大家下来试验过没有。直接用IPv6地址来进行诸如远程访问这种操作的话,光是地址的输入都很麻烦。为了保证能随时访问家中的设备,就需要...【详细内容】
2020-09-07  Tags: IPv6  点击:(279)  评论:(0)  加入收藏
拓扑 规格 适用于V200R002C00及以上版本、所有形态的AR路由器。 组网需求 PC直连Router的接口后可通过协议自动获取IPv6地址,并自动生成默认网关,从而使PC与路由器可以自动连...【详细内容】
2020-09-04  Tags: IPv6  点击:(852)  评论:(0)  加入收藏
一、IPv6背景1、IPv4公网地址用尽2、实现万物互联3、互联网发展如此迅猛必须能够提供足够的IP地址二、 IPv6和IPv4报头1、IPv4报头 2、IPv6报头 三、IPv6地址分类1、单播地...【详细内容】
2020-09-04  Tags: IPv6  点击:(106)  评论:(0)  加入收藏
▌简易百科推荐
以京训钉开发平台接口文档为例,使用HttpClient类请求调用其接口,对数据进行增删改查等操作。 文档地址: https://www.yuque.com/bjjnts/jxd/bo1oszusing System;using System.C...【详细内容】
2021-12-28  Wednes    Tags:HttpClient   点击:(1)  评论:(0)  加入收藏
阿里云与爱快路由安装组网教程一、开通好阿里云轻量服务器之后在服务器运维-远程连接处进行远程 二、进入控制台后在root权限下根据需要安装的固件位数复制下面命令。32位:wg...【详细内容】
2021-12-28  ikuai    Tags:组网   点击:(1)  评论:(0)  加入收藏
HTTP 报文是在应用程序之间发送的数据块,这些数据块将通过以文本形式的元信息开头,用于 HTTP 协议交互。请求端(客户端)的 HTTP 报文叫做请求报文,响应端(服务器端)的叫做响应...【详细内容】
2021-12-27  程序员蛋蛋    Tags:HTTP 报文   点击:(5)  评论:(0)  加入收藏
一 网络概念:1.带宽: 标识网卡的最大传输速率,单位为 b/s,比如 1Gbps,10Gbps,相当于马路多宽2.吞吐量: 单位时间内传输数据量大小单位为 b/s 或 B/s ,吞吐量/带宽,就是网络的使用率...【详细内容】
2021-12-27  码农世界    Tags:网络   点击:(3)  评论:(0)  加入收藏
1.TCP/IP 网络模型有几层?分别有什么用? TCP/IP网络模型总共有五层 1.应用层:我们能接触到的就是应用层了,手机,电脑这些这些设备都属于应用层。 2.传输层:就是为应用层提供网络...【详细内容】
2021-12-22  憨猪哥08    Tags:TCP/IP   点击:(35)  评论:(0)  加入收藏
TCP握手的时候维护的队列 半连接队列(SYN队列) 全连接队列(accepted队列)半连接队列是什么?服务器收到客户端SYN数据包后,Linux内核会把该连接存储到半连接队列中,并响应SYN+ACK报...【详细内容】
2021-12-21  DifferentJava    Tags:TCP   点击:(10)  评论:(0)  加入收藏
你好,这里是科技前哨。 随着“元宇宙”概念的爆火,下一代互联网即将到来,也成了互联网前沿热议的话题,12月9日美国众议院的听证会上,共和党议员Patrick McHenry甚至宣称,要调整现...【详细内容】
2021-12-17  王煜全    Tags:Web3   点击:(14)  评论:(0)  加入收藏
一、demopublic static void main(String[] args) throws Exception { RetryPolicy retryPolicy = new ExponentialBackoffRetry( 1000, 3);...【详细内容】
2021-12-15  程序员阿龙    Tags:Curator   点击:(22)  评论:(0)  加入收藏
一、计算机网络概述 1.1 计算机网络的分类按照网络的作用范围:广域网(WAN)、城域网(MAN)、局域网(LAN);按照网络使用者:公用网络、专用网络。1.2 计算机网络的层次结构 TCP/IP四层模...【详细内容】
2021-12-14  一口Linux    Tags:网络知识   点击:(31)  评论:(0)  加入收藏
无论是在外面还是在家里,许多人都习惯了用手机连接 WiFi 进行上网。不知道大家有没有遇到过这样一种情况, 明明已经显示成功连接 WiFi,却仍然提示“网络不可用”或“不可上网”...【详细内容】
2021-12-14  UGREEN绿联    Tags:WiFi   点击:(25)  评论:(0)  加入收藏
最新更新
栏目热门
栏目头条